Private credit grew from a $250B asset class in 2010 to around $1.5T in early 2024
That's partly due to the industry's rising interest rates that created more upside for investors. Interest rates have increased in recent years alongside the Federal Reserve's interest rate hikes beginning in 2022. Private credit loans typically stretch over multiple years (typically between five and seven years, although term lengths vary).
